## Partner SFTP drop — who owns it

Quick reference for the weekly sync: the Lorimer partner SFTP drop (nightly inventory files from our partner Tallgrass Goods) is owned by the Integrations crew. If files stop landing by 03:00, it's usually their upload job, not our poller — check the intake dashboard before escalating. Key rotations happen quarterly and are handled by Integrations too. For missing files, schema changes, or anything partner-facing, write to the integrations shared inbox below.

escalation mailbox, bafog-fafog: ulador@paliqlabs.internal

Subject: Handover — KeyTurner rotation utility

Hi Mirelle, handing off KeyTurner releases to you. The utility rotates internal secrets nightly; releases must be cut from the frozen branch only, and every rotation manifest has to be signed before the scheduler will accept it. Documentation lives in the runbook folder. The signing key you'll need is below.

rollout seal: bky4_DFM9

**Ticket: Kiosk watchdog restarts Wayfindr shell during idle screensaver**

The watchdog misreads the screensaver's reduced heartbeat cadence as a hang and force-restarts the shell roughly every forty minutes on lobby units. Logs confirm the heartbeat thread is alive but throttled. Repro is reliable on the affected firmware; the suspect build is noted below.

session token of kageg-tahop = htk14_af3c1ccccb7dcf

## Configuration

Plugin authors: Brindlemoor agents tolerate up to 90 seconds of clock skew. Beyond that, artifact signatures are rejected and your plugin's steps fail closed. Do not compensate for skew in plugin code; fix NTP on the agent. Skew telemetry is pushed to the coordinator, which authenticates via the key set on the next line.

vault entry, yahaf-tagug: LEDGER_TOKEN20=884d77d1a8b98aa4edfb